Determine the deflection of the beam in Problem 7.18. E = 12.0 GPa for the yellow pine.

A timber member 250 mm wide by 300 mm deep by 4.2 m long is used as a simple beam on a span of 4 m. It is subjected to a concentrated load P at midspan. The plane of the loads makes an angle ϕ = 5π/9 with the horizontal x axis. The beam is made of yellow pine with a yield stress Y = 25.0 MPa. The beam has been designed with a factor of safety SF = 2.50 against initiation of yielding. Determine the magnitude of P and the orientation of the neutral axis.
